When should I get my baby’s ears pierced?

Your questions

Marie, my baby Jasmine is three months old, and I am hesitant about piercing her ears. Do you have recommendations you can share? Thanks in advance and thank you for everything you do! Camille


Camille, that’s a good question because, before three months of age, we don’t recommend getting a baby’s ears pierced. It’s often better at five or six months due to several things you need to consider. Please read my article that talks about piercing a baby’s ears.
